Rangpur - Shikarpur, Bulandshahr
Rangpur is a village situated in the Shikarpur tehsil of Bulandshahr district, Uttar Pradesh. It is located approximately 12 km from the tehsil headquarters in Shikarpur and around 17 km from the district headquarters in Bulandshahr. Rangpur village is a designated Gram Panchayat.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Rangpur is 121347. The village covers a total geographical area of 330.57 hectares and falls under the 203001 pincode. Shikarpur is the nearest town, located about 12 km away.
Rangpur village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Gram Pradhan serving as the elected head.
Population of Rangpur
According to the 2011 Census, Rangpur village had a total population of 3,454 people, including 1,782 males and 1,672 females, living in 594 households. The sex ratio was 938 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 70.03%, with male literacy at 84.05% and female literacy at 55.42%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 580.

Transport and Connectivity of Rangpur
Rangpur is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Maman, while the nearest airport is Indira Gandhi International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 74.4 km.
